Output 84a60c1952f589008738818634e621e47d7eb8a267fb7b42657110ed53e8e736:0

value
1001953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21effea7ab8c3291cb7186b7162378b95b5f69db OP_EQUAL
address
34nTj136hB5VTd4LuH2aSrJQzJh38AMHKq
transaction
84a60c1952f589008738818634e621e47d7eb8a267fb7b42657110ed53e8e736
spent
true